McPherson - Model 642 -Soft X-ray Solid Anode Electron Impact Source
The Model 642 soft x-ray source is a compact, convenient to operate source for the 2keV to 50eV region. The unique dual-output of equivalent beams make it a useful source for many comparative applications in addition to wavelength calibration and so on. The two output beams originate from two views of the single emitting spot where the electron beam from the single hairpin filament collides with the interchangeable anode. The emitting spot is about 1mm diameter and depends on the source’s operating conditions.
The Model 642 is available as a single anode source. The anodes may easily be exchanged at atmosphere. The larger Model 642-1 is even more flexible. It has a multiple-anode carousel allowing the user to exchange anode materials without breaking vacuum. Both sources are good candidates for soft x-ray measurement and calibration applications. The soft x-ray sources are provided with a filament current controller and 10kV high voltage supply for operation up to 30 Watts. Option exists to water cool the anodes and operate with power high as 300 Watts. Please inquire.

- Source: Accelerated electron impact, solid anode
- Wavelength range: Line emission from << 1nm to 25nm
- Flux in bright lines: ~10E11 photons sec-1 sterradian-1
- Source Emission: Anode material valence bands:
- Emission uniformity: Dual beam output, balanced
- Power Supply: 10kV VDC required sold separate (see Model 7640)
- Operating pressure: 10E-6 torr range or lower
- Size: approximately cylindrical, 5" diameter x 13" long
- Weight: 4 lbs
